Tim Meddick replied to Mammad DN
15-Nov-09 07:52 PM

This is a multi-part message in MIME format.
------=_NextPart_000_0044_01CA6657.1615B630
Content-Type: text/plain;
format=flowed;
charset="iso-8859-1";
reply-type=response
Content-Transfer-Encoding: 7bit
EXE (executable or program) files are not opened by any other program or dll, but are
sent directly to the CPU to be executed or "run".
In the registry, non-executable files such as .doc or .txt files are associated with
a program via a replaceable parameter in the registry after a command-line to open
that program.
This replaceable parameter is represented by "%1" in the registry after the
command-line to open the program that, in turn, opens the .doc (or other
non-executable) file.
So, in the registry under the command entry for .txt files, for instance, you would get
the following line :
C:\WINDOWS\system32\notepad.exe %1
...where the "%1" replaceable parameter would be "replaced", by Windows, with the
path to the .txt file to be opened.
With .EXE files, which do not need any other file to open [execute] them, all you get
in the registry to associate with them is the replaceable parameter itself - "%1" -
meaning to just execute itself and NOT be preceded by a program name such as
notepad.exe in the above example.
As I can see you are using OE to access this newsgroup, I will attach a simple
registry file that contains the correct association for .EXE files (i.e : just
Just double click on this file and answer [ok] to import it.
==
Cheers, Tim Meddick, Peckham, London. :-)
------=_NextPart_000_0044_01CA6657.1615B630
Content-Type: application/octet-stream;
name="exefile.reg"
Content-Transfer-Encoding: base64
Content-Disposition: attachment;
filename="exefile.reg"
//5XAGkAbgBkAG8AdwBzACAAUgBlAGcAaQBzAHQAcgB5ACAARQBkAGkAdABvAHIAIABWAGUAcgBz
AGkAbwBuACAANQAuADAAMAAN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8A
TwBUAFwALgBlAHgAZQBdAA0ACgBAAD0AIgBlAHgAZQBmAGkAbABlACIADQAKACIAQwBvAG4AdABl
AG4AdAAgAFQAeQBwAGUAIgA9ACIAYQBwAHAAbABpAGMAYQB0AGkAbwBuAC8AeAAtAG0AcwBkAG8A
dwBuAGwAbwBhAGQAIgAN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8ATwBU
AFwALgBlAHgAZQBcAFAAZQByAHMAaQBzAHQAZQBuAHQASABhAG4AZABsAGUAcgBdAA0ACgBAAD0A
IgB7ADAAOQA4AGYAMgA0ADcAMAAtAGIAYQBlADAALQAxADEAYwBkAC0AYgA1ADcAOQAtADAAOAAw
ADAAMgBiADMAMABiAGYAZQBiAH0AIgAN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MA
XwBSAE8ATwBUAFwAZQB4AGUAZgBpAGwAZQBdAA0ACgBAAD0AIgBBAHAAcABsAGkAYwBhAHQAaQBv
AG4AIgANAAoAIgBFAGQAaQB0AEYAbABhAGcAcwAiAD0AaABlAHgAOgAzADgALAAwADcALAAwADAA
LAAwADAADQAKAA0ACgBbAEgASwBFAFkAXwBDAEwAQQBTAFMARQBTAF8AUgBPAE8AVABcAGUAeABl
AGYAaQBsAGUAXABEAGUAZgBhAHUAbAB0AEkAYwBvAG4AXQANAAoAQAA9ACIAJQAxACIADQAKAA0A
CgBbAEgASwBFAFkAXwBDAEwAQQBTAFMARQBTAF8AUgBPAE8AVABcAGUAeABlAGYAaQBsAGUAXABz
AGgAZQBsAGwAXQANAAoAQAA9ACIAIgAN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MA
XwBSAE8ATwBUAFwAZQB4AGUAZgBpAGwAZQBcAHMAaABlAGwAbABcAG8AcABlAG4AXQANAAoAQAA9
ACIAIgAN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8ATwBUAFwAZQB4AGUA
ZgBpAGwAZQBcAHMAaABlAGwAbABcAG8AcABlAG4AXABjAG8AbQBtAGEAbgBkAF0ADQAKAEAAPQAi
AFwAIgAlADEAXAAiACAAJQAqACIADQAKAA0ACgBbAEgASwBFAFkAXwBDAEwAQQBTAFMARQBTAF8A
UgBPAE8AVABcAGUAeABlAGYAaQBsAGUAXABzAGgAZQBsAGwAXAByAHUAbgBhAHMAXQANAAoADQAK
AF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8ATwBUAFwAZQB4AGUAZgBpAGwAZQBcAHMA
aABlAGwAbABcAHIAdQBuAGEAcwBcAGMAbwBtAG0AYQBuAGQAXQANAAoAQAA9ACIAXAAiACUAMQBc
ACIAIAAlACoAIgAN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8ATwBUAFwA
ZQB4AGUAZgBpAGwAZQBcAHMAaABlAGwAbABlAHgAXQANAAoADQAKAFsASABLAEUAWQBfAEMATABB
AFMAUwBFAFMAXwBSAE8ATwBUAFwAZQB4AGUAZgBpAGwAZQBcAHMAaABlAGwAbABlAHgAXABEAHIA
bwBwAEgAYQBuAGQAbABlAHIAXQANAAoAQAA9ACIAewA4ADYAQwA4ADYANwAyADAALQA0ADIAQQAw
AC0AMQAwADYAOQAtAEEAMgBFADgALQAwADgAMAAwADIAQgAzADAAMwAwADkARAB9ACIADQAKAA0A
CgBbAEgASwBFAFkAXwBDAEwAQQBTAFMARQBTAF8AUgBPAE8AVABcAGUAeABlAGYAaQBsAGUAXABz
AGgAZQBsAGwAZQB4AFwAUAByAG8AcABlAHIAdAB5AFMAaABlAGUAdABIAGEAbgBkAGwAZQByAHMA
XQANAAoADQAKAFsASABLAEUAWQBfAEMATABBAFMAUwBFAFMAXwBSAE8ATwBUAFwAZQB4AGUAZgBp
AGwAZQBcAHMAaABlAGwAbABlAHgAXABQAHIAbwBwAGUAcgB0AHkAUwBoAGUAZQB0AEgAYQBuAGQA
bABlAHIAcwBcAFAAaQBmAFAAcgBvAHAAcwBdAA0ACgBAAD0AIgB7ADgANgBGADEAOQBBADAAMAAt
ADQAMgBBADAALQAxADAANgA5AC0AQQAyAEUAOQAtADAAOAAwADAAMgBCADMAMAAzADAAOQBEAH0A
IgANAAoADQAKAA0ACgA=
------=_NextPart_000_0044_01CA6657.1615B630--